To safely ship heavy clothing without ripping, choose a poly mailer with a thickness of 2.5 to 3.15 mils (63 to 80 microns). Heavy apparel like jeans, coats, and hoodies requires this heavy-duty gauge to withstand puncture and tearing during transit. For standard apparel, 2.0 mils is sufficient, but heavy items demand a minimum of 2.5 mils for secure delivery.

Detailed Architectural/Principle Analysis

The structural integrity of a poly mailer depends on the polymer formulation and the extrusion method. Co-extruded (Co-ex) polyethylene combines multiple layers of low-density polyethylene (LDPE) into a single, high-strength film. This multi-layer construction distributes physical forces evenly across the surface, preventing localized failure. Heavy clothing puts dynamic pressure on the seams of the packaging when dropped or stacked. Data/Solution Comparison

Choosing the correct thickness depends on the specific weight and characteristics of the garment being shipped. Below is a comparative guide to thickness applications and performance benchmarks:

Thickness (Mil / Microns) Target Apparel Types Tear Resistance Rating Waterproof Protection Recommended Application
1.5 - 2.0 Mil (38 - 51μm) T-shirts, activewear, socks, light shirts Standard High Conventional Courier Bags for Logistics
2.5 - 3.0 Mil (63 - 76μm) Jeans, sweaters, hoodies, denim jackets High Excellent E-commerce & Logistics Industry
3.15 Mil+ (80μm+) Winter coats, heavy leather jackets, boots Maximum Excellent Cross-border E-commerce (Amazon & FBA)

What closure method is best for thick, heavy-duty shipping bags?

A permanent self-seal closure featuring high-tack hot-melt adhesive is best. This closure chemically bonds with the co-extruded plastic film, creating a tamper-evident, waterproof seal that cannot be pulled open without destroying the bag.
